clip the end of the leader under a clipboard clip
or
glue a clothespin to a chopstick, stick the chopstick into the ground, and secure the end of the leader with the clothespin
or
ask someone to stand on the leader
they all work!

Subject: {Tidal Potomac Fly Rodders} CI Test Prep: Roll Casting on Grass
Question for the CIs and other test preppers: What system do you use to practice the roll cast tasks on grass. I'm planning to start experimenting with a "grass leader" but was wondering if there's another system that doesn't require me to get a second rod setup just for roll casts. Also, I would obviously prefer to practice with whatever setup(s) I'm most likely to see on the exam.
